Job Description:
SUMMARY: To create a flexible elementary grade program and a class environment favorable to learning and personal growth; to establish effective rapport with pupils; to motivate pupils to develop skills, attitudes and knowledge needed to provide a good foundation for elementary grade education, provide additional time and support students need to master curriculum; and to establish good relationships with parents and with other staff members. 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: (Other duties may be assigned.)
Teaches district-approved curriculum. Instruct pupils in citizenship and basic subject matter specified in state law and administrative regulations and procedures of the school district. Develops lesson plans and instructional material and provides individualized and small group instruction to adapt the curriculum to the needs of each pupil. Translates lesson plans into developmentally appropriate learning experiences. Communicates regularly with parents outside normal classroom day by means of newsletters, notes, phone calls, conferences, email, etc. Establishes and maintains standards of pupil behavior to achieve an effective learning atmosphere using research based strategies. Evaluates pupils' academic and social growth, keeps appropriate records and prepares progress reports and uses data to guide educational decisions. Identifies pupil needs and makes appropriate referrals and develops strategies for individual education plans, provides extra time and support for each student. Is available to students and parents for education-related purposes outside the instructional day. Plans and coordinates the work of paraprofessionals, parents, and volunteers in the classroom and on field trips. Creates an environment for learning through functional and attractive displays interest centers and exhibits of student's work.  Develops and maintains standard based assessments that are used to drive Tier I, II, and III instruction. Utilizes research based instructional strategies. S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ES: Supervises classroom, students, and volunteers. QUALIFICATION REQUIREMENTS: The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ge, skill, and/or ability required.
